Prevaccination Glycan Markers of Response to an Influenza Vaccine Implicate the Complement Pathway

Abstract: A key to improving vaccine design and vaccination strategy is to understand the mechanism behind the variation of vaccine response with host factors. Glycosylation, a critical modulator of immunity, has no clear role in determining vaccine responses. “…High-throughput glycomic analysis using our established array technology has revealed new roles for glycans in cancer biology, 17 host–pathogen interactions, 18 , 19 and vaccine response. 20 In brief, each sample was fluorescently labeled ( S , Alexa Fluor 555 labeled) and mixed with an equal amount of an orthogonally labeled reference standard ( R , Alexa Fluor 647 labeled commercial plasma). Samples were analyzed using in-house fabricated lectin microarrays containing >95 probes ( Tables S4 and S5 ), as previously described.…”

“…One study examined the transcriptome in human PBMCs and showed that the expression of nine genes is associated with seroconversion against the flu vaccine after adjusting for the baseline antibody titers [23]. A more recent study using lectin microarrays and glycoproteomics found that the serum glycan Le a is associated with the serological response to the flu vaccine, and further, that Le a -binding proteins are enriched in the complement system [24].…”
